Sharpening and Sharpening Your Knives



Developing and developing blades is an important skill for butchers, as sharp devices enhance effectiveness and precision in cutting. Normal maintenance of knives not only boosts performance but also guarantees safety and security during cooking. Butchers must understand the distinction between developing and sharpening; developing removes product to recover the blade's edge, while refining aligns the edge for optimal cutting.To sharpen knives, making use of a whetstone or professional honing solution is recommended. It is important to keep the appropriate angle throughout honing to attain a consistent edge. Refining can be performed with a honing steel, which should be used often to keep knives in prime condition.Butchers need to likewise know the material of their knives, as various kinds need details treatment techniques. A properly maintained knife will result in much less exhaustion and far better end results, making sharpening and honing a crucial component of butchery equipment care.


Inspecting and Maintaining Saws and Grinders



Regular evaluation and maintenance of saws and grinders is vital for ensuring peak efficiency and durability of butchery devices. Operators must regularly inspect saw blades for wear and damage, trying to find nicks or dullness that could affect reducing effectiveness. Cleaning up the blades after each use assists protect against build-up and rust, improving their lifespan.Grinders also call for interest; operators should evaluate grinding plates and blades for signs of wear or misalignment. Regularly oiling relocating parts warranties smooth operation and reduces possible break downs. It is necessary to tighten up all screws and screws to avoid resonances that can cause mechanical failure.Additionally, checking electric connections and cables for fraying or damage is essential for safety and security. By adhering to a proactive upkeep schedule, butchers can minimize downtime and prolong the life of their saws and grinders, inevitably supporting a more effective and productive workplace.

Efficiency Anomalies



Numerous subtle efficiency abnormalities can indicate deterioration on butchery tools, which may jeopardize performance and safety. A recognizable decrease in cutting sharpness can indicate that blades are plain and call for interest. Devices may also exhibit unusual vibrations or sounds, recommending misalignment or interior damage that could affect performance. Furthermore, irregular meat appearance or irregular cuts may indicate that machinery is not operating at its finest. Boosted functional temperature levels can aim to overheating electric motors or rubbing in between components, risking potential failure. Routinely keeping an eye on these indicators is essential, as they can bring about even more substantial concerns if left unaddressed. Prompt acknowledgment of these abnormalities is necessary for keeping capability and ensuring a secure workplace in butchery procedures
